    The land reform in principle is the right thing to do especaily in countries such as Namibia and South Africa where majority of Africans still linger in poverty. Land is everything! But the way it was executed in Zimbabwe it was flawed from the word go!

    In Zimbabwe the cronies of Mugabe own huge tracts of land and only a small portion of of land is really distributed to the war veterans ( and by the way some war veterans are said to be 18 years old, that gets you thinking.)

    Land reform needs to take place but in orderly way that benefits those who ARE CURRENTLY DISADVANTAGED.

    On the issues of whether Mugabe is a hero or not, there numerous publications written by black patriotic africans on how Mugabe manipulated,tortured and maimed fellow politicans one such example is Joshua Nkomo. Apart from the education in Zimbabwe the hastily conducted land reform is one among many of Mugabes flawed project.
